Fall into nature with Plantlife: Waxcap watercolours
If you explore wooded and grassed areas in the early winter months, you will discover a whole world of beautiful living organisms known as fungi. Join artist / tutor Beth Morris to create spooky characters inspired by the waxy, gem-like, shiny cups of this attractive fungi family. We’ll be using mixed media, collage and water-colour paint to develop a set of characters based on the expressively named Earth Tongues, Crimson, and the Glutinous Wax-caps. You will also need to get your imaginative brains working to try and decide on the personality of Mr Hygrocybe Puniecea!! Beth will demonstrate how to draw and paint the wax-caps, adding extra eerie and ghostly accessories fitting for the time of year. You will also learn to create a mind map in order to build your own Halloween story for these mysterious waxy creatures.
